Best answer to the question «How can I Help my Cat maintain good dental health?»

Dental toys are another great option to help maintain your cat’s dental health while also providing exercise and mental stimulation. Some of these have a net-like material that can act similarly to dental floss for humans. Other toys may contain pet-safe natural fibers to encourage chewing behavior. Always monitor your pet’s play.

😻 What are common dental problems with cats?

  • Plaque. Plaque is a soft film of bacteria and food debris that accumulates every day and sticks to the surface of a cat’s teeth.

How does Kibble shape affect my cat’s dental health?
A kibble’s shape and size can impact many things like: Dental health – It is important that the cat’s teeth penetrate the kibble so that a ‘brushing effect’ can be achieved. This may help to reduce plaque, which can lead to tartar and encourages good oral health.

Does my cat need dental care?
Taking care of your cat’s teeth is about much more than aesthetics. All cats need good dental care to help avoid periodontal disease and other issues that can impact their health and quality of life. While cats are not prone to cavities like humans, they can suffer from other dental issues.

Why is good dental health important for my cat's health?
Good dental health is important for your well-being, and it's very important for your cat's health, too. What is dental disease? It can be difficult to keep your cat's teeth clean, so dental health problems are very common. In fact, research shows that at around the age of 2, 70% of cats have some sign of dental disease.

How can I protect my cat’s dental health?
Regular dental visits and tooth brushing will protect your kitty’s dental health. Both Dr. Reiter and Dr. Carmichael tout the benefits of daily tooth brushing for cats, as it prevents the buildup of bacteria that cause many dental issues.
Is dry food good for my cat's dental health?
Dry foods are not good for your cat's dental health. People like to think that dry foods help clean a cat's teeth, but the opposite is true. According to Dr. Guillermo Díaz, MV: "The shape of the kibble is generally small in size which makes it very difficult for a cat to chew on, so they generally swallow the whole pellet as presented.

How can I tell if my cat has good dental health?
If your cat has healthy energy, that’s a great indicator of good overall health. Healthy cat teeth are free of tartar and plaque. You can tell if your cat is developing either of these by looking at his or her back teeth – there shouldn’t be any unusual yellowing or darkening back there.
